Saret, Larry L. was born on August 27, 1950 in Chicago, Illinois, United States.
Cornell University (Bachelor of Arts, 1972). Loyola University (Juris Doctor, 1975). Student Articles Editor, Loyola University Law Journal, 1974-1975.
Worked at Laff, Whitesel, Conte & Saret, Limited., A Professional Corporation (Chicago, Illinois) specializing in Patent Law, Trademark Law, Copyright Law, Unfair Competition Law, Litigation. Admitted to the bar, 1975, Illinois and United States. District Court, Northern District of Illinois.
1976, United States.
Court of Appeals, 7th Circuit. 1982, United States.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it. 1985, United States. Court of Appeals, 11th Circuit.
1986, United States.
Supreme Court. Registered to practice before United States. Patent and Trademark Office.
Student Articles Editor, Loyola University Law Journal, 1974-1975. Adjunct Professor, Intellectual Property Law, Loyola University of Chicago School of Law, 1996.
Author: "Unfairness Without Deception: Recent Positions of the Federal Trade Commission," 5 Loyola University Law Journal 537, 1974.
Reprinted in Advertising Law Anthology, Volume III, 1975. "Foreword: The Current State of Advertising Law," Advertising Law Anthology Volume IV, 1976. Company-author, "Further Unraveling of SearsCompco: Of Patches, Paladin and Laurel & Hardy," 7 Loyola University Law Journal 33, 1976.
Reprinted in 66 Trademark Reporter 427, 1976.
Company-author, "Publicity and Privacy Distinct Interests on the Misappropriation Continuum," 12 Loyola University Law Journal 675, 1981. Member: Chicago, Illinois State and American Bar Associations.
Intellectual Property Law Association of Chicago.
Member American Bar Association, Illinois Bar Association, Chicago Bar Association, Patent Law Association of Chicago.
